Dissipation inequalities for the analysis of a class of PDEs [PDF]

open access: yes, 2016
In this paper, we develop dissipation inequalities for a class of well-posed systems described by partial differential equations (PDEs). We study passivity, reachability, induced input–output norm boundedness, and input-to-state stability (ISS).

A PDES method preserving boundaries on dense disparity map reconstruction

open access: yes, 2008
Over smoothness restricts the application of PDEs in the field of dense disparity map reconstruction, because disparity map reconstruction usually requires preserving discontinuousness in some areas such as the boundaries of objects.
